What Makes Tactical Games So Addictive?
Tactical games are all about strategy and planning. Players must assess situations, weigh risks and rewards, and make informed decisions to achieve victory. This process is deeply engaging, as players must balance short-term goals with long-term objectives, making every decision count. The sense of accomplishment that comes from outmaneuvering opponents or overcoming seemingly insurmountable challenges is unparalleled, fostering a loyal following among gamers.
The Evolution of Tactical Games
From the early days of tabletop miniatures to the latest releases on PC and console platforms, tactical games have come a long way. Modern games have incorporated cutting-edge graphics, AI-driven opponents, and innovative multiplayer features, making the experience more immersive and dynamic than ever. The genre has also branched out, incorporating elements from other genres, such as role-playing games (RPGs) and real-time strategy (RTS) games.
Top Tactical Games to Watch
1. Into the Breach: A turn-based strategy game where players control a team of mechs, working together to defeat an alien invasion.
2. XCOM 2: A classic tactical RPG where players lead a team of soldiers in a fight against an alien occupation.
3. They Are Billions: A real-time strategy game set in a steampunk world, where players must build and defend colonies from hordes of zombies.
4. Wargroove: A turn-based strategy game with a focus on campaign and multiplayer modes, featuring a unique art style and intricate gameplay mechanics.
